The History Behind Princess Diana's Legendary Iconic Ring

Though countless royal treasures hold legends of splendor, Princess Diana's celebrated ring remains exceptional for its extraordinary significance and distinctive style. Crafted in 1981 by the jeweler Garrard, the ring features a magnificent 12-carat oval blue sapphire, surrounded by 14 diamonds, mounted in white gold. This distinctive selection captured Diana's individual taste and her willingness to challenge established royal customs. The ring came to represent her spirit—fearless, refined, and distinctly her own.

The history of the ring is remarkably captivating. At the time of Prince Charles's proposal, Diana picked it from a catalog, a gesture that reflected her down-to-earth nature and contemporary perspective on royal life. As time passed, the ring surpassed its tangible value, symbolizing love, perseverance, and a timeless heritage. After Diana's passing, the ring was worn by her son's fiancée, strengthening its ties to present-day royal history and establishing its legacy as an enduring piece of jewelry.

Which Materials Were Used in Princess Diana's Famous Engagement Ring?

The engagement ring of Princess Diana showcased a breathtaking 12-carat sapphire in deep blue encircled by fourteen brilliant diamonds, set in 18-karat white gold. This combination of materials conveyed both elegance and uniqueness, making the ring truly iconic.

How Much Was Princess Diana's Ring Originally Worth?

The engagement ring of Princess Diana originally cost approximately £30,000, an amount that represented its intricate design and the featuring of a prominent sapphire encircled by diamonds. The value of the ring has risen significantly since it was first purchased.

Where Is Princess Diana's Ring Now?

Princess Diana's iconic ring is presently in the possession of Catherine, Princess of Wales. She received it from Prince William, serving as a meaningful tribute to Diana and her timeless influence on the royal family.
